Carbon monoxide detectors generally have seven to 10 12 months warranties. Electric power Resource You will find 3 principal power sources for carbon monoxide detectors: wire, plug-in, or battery. Koether endorses heading Together with the wire or plug-in having a backup battery. This is due to “if the ability is off, you have comprehensive electricity With all the battery, and If you have energy, it’s employing that in lieu of draining the battery.” Warn Type Most carbon monoxide detectors use loud noises to get your notice.
The compact guardians measure the amount of carbon monoxide has saturated a space, and may sound an alarm when it reaches risky amounts.
Carbon monoxide detectors, often called alarms, get the job done the same as a smoke alarm. If they detect perilous amounts of carbon monoxide inside the air, they established off an alarm to warn you.
